Enjoy this historic 1920's building completely redesigned and updated in 2014 by a local builder with a great reputation for quality materials and workmanship. Originally built and owned by Hanbie D. Hawk, it became the love of his life and was well known in Springfield's high society as "the" place to live. Those who lived at the apartments, knew about its reputation as a warm and friendly place. In later years, it was transformed into a local Cafe and later into an Ice Cream Parlor. Located at the corner of Monroe and Lewis Street, it is in the heart of the near west side, close to downtown and the Illinois State Capitol complex. To preserve the old-time charm of this 1920's building, the original hardwood flooring in the spacious hallways and studios were restored as well as the original tile in the entrance foyer.
